小编mct*_*987的帖子

如何忽略Firefox中的"Content-Disposition:attachment"

我怎样才能导致Firefox 忽略Content-Disposition: attachment头?我发现我无法在浏览器中查看图像,因为它要求我下载它.

我不想下载文件,我只想在浏览器中查看它.如果浏览器没有插件来处理它,那么它应该要求下载.

例如,我安装了Adobe Acrobat Reader作为Firefox的插件.我单击指向PDF的链接,它会要求我保存它,当它应该使用插件在浏览器中打开时.如果服务器未Content-Disposition: attachment在响应中发送标头,则会出现这种情况.

Firefox 3.6.6 Windows XP SP3

browser firefox http download

22
推荐指数
2
解决办法
7523
查看次数

如何在dojo中获取FilteringSelect <select>的"值"?

我正在使用dijit.form.FilteringSelect来提供一种从<select>中选择值的方法.问题是,当使用dojo时,返回标签而不是s的值.

例如: 如果选择了该选项,Dojo将返回文字"one",而不是该选项的值"1"."2"和"2"也是如此.
<select name="test" dojoType="dijit.form.FilteringSelect">
<option value="1">One</option>
<option value="2">Two</option>
</select>

如果从此元素中删除了dojo,则会按预期返回该值.

html javascript forms dojo

10
推荐指数
4
解决办法
3万
查看次数

使用application/xml + xhtml内容类型的Dojo

我怎样才能将Dojo Dijits(目前为1.5.0)与XHTML一起用作application/xml + xhtml?如果以text/html格式发送,则有效,但需要application/xml + xhtml.

这似乎与dijit.form.DatePicker和其他几个有关.

这不是针对验证W3C的一个问题,它只是简单的不工作,在所有.

Error: mismatched tag. Expected: </br>.
Source File: 
Line: 5, Column: 54
Source Code:
  ><div class="dijitReset dijitValidationIcon"><br></div
Run Code Online (Sandbox Code Playgroud)

由于此错误,JavaScript执行停止.

显然,我可以重新编译Dojo,并单独修复所有这些,但这是很多工作,并没有解决所有问题.

再一次,它适用于text/html,但是需要application/xml + xhtml.

javascript xhtml dojo xhtml-1.1 mime-types

6
推荐指数
1
解决办法
594
查看次数

Trac使用数据库身份验证

是否可以使用数据库进行Trac身份验证?在此安装中不需要.htpasswd auth.

使用Trac .11和MySQL作为数据库.Trac当前正在使用数据库,但不提供身份验证.

python mysql apache trac

5
推荐指数
1
解决办法
923
查看次数

在Zend Framework中更改模块名称

ZF 1.9.6尝试根据请求的用户代理更改模块.当我尝试从Front获取请求对象时,我得到NULL.

目前我正在尝试从我创建的Bootstrap _initModule方法设置模块名称.

$front = Zend_Controller_Front::getInstance();
$request = $front->getRequest(); // This is NULL
$request = new Zend_Controller_Request_Http();
$request->setModuleName('iphone');
$front->setRequest($request);
Run Code Online (Sandbox Code Playgroud)

但是,执行时,它仍然会进入"默认"模块.

php zend-framework

3
推荐指数
1
解决办法
2232
查看次数